News summary

The origins of the cheeseburger, a staple in American cuisine, are shrouded in mystery, with various claims to its invention dating back to the 1920s and 1930s. A notable claim comes from a now-defunct sandwich stand in Pasadena, California, which celebrated its role in popularizing the cheeseburger alongside the iconic Route 66. Meanwhile, Texas Roadhouse continues to grow rapidly, with plans to expand to 900 locations by the end of 2025, known for its hearty portions and signature rolls. However, health experts warn that these rolls, while delicious, may contribute to overeating due to their high sugar content that spikes blood-glucose levels. Despite these concerns, many diners remain loyal to the rolls, often enjoying them with the restaurant's cinnamon butter. The tension between indulgence and health awareness reflects broader trends in American dining habits.
